How FCL shipping works in this decision
For how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china, FCL shipping is exclusive use of a container and is commonly considered for larger cargo or operational control. The quotation and outcome depend on container utilization, loading, detention, demurrage and delivery. Compare the same origin, destination, service scope, cargo data, customs responsibility, and delivery point.
| Quote field | Confirm |
|---|---|
| Cargo data | pieces, cartons, gross weight, dimensions, commodity and value |
| Route scope | pickup, export, main transport, destination handling and delivery |
| Time definition | booking, cutoff, departure, transit estimate and delivery conditions |
| Customs | declarant, importer, classification, taxes and required records |
| Exceptions | remote areas, exams, storage, dangerous goods, oversize and peak surcharges |

Calculate the commercial exposure
For how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china, separate quoted facts from assumptions. The lowest unit price can produce the highest delivered cost when packaging, chargeable weight, defects, delays, or omitted services are ignored.
| Cost layer | Include |
|---|---|
| Product | unit price, samples, setup, tooling and overage |
| China-side | domestic freight, warehouse, inspection, repacking and export handling |
| International | main freight, surcharges, insurance and destination handling |
| Import | duty, VAT or tax, brokerage, examinations and storage |
| Failure allowance | rework, replacements, delays and unsellable inventory |

Mistakes that change the outcome
Comparing unequal quotations
For how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china, one supplier may include packaging and domestic delivery while another quotes only the product. Normalize scope before treating a price difference as a saving.
Approving through scattered messages
Use one versioned specification and approval record for how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china.
Paying before evidence
For how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china, final payment before agreed completion and inspection evidence can remove leverage while rework is still possible.
Ignoring packaging and shipping
For how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china, a sellable product can become unsellable through weak cartons, excess volumetric weight, incorrect labels, or an unsuitable import route.

Approve retail and export packaging separately
Packaging for how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china affects customer experience, damage rate, carton dimensions, chargeable weight, labeling, and warehouse handling. Approve retail presentation and export protection as separate requirements because attractive packaging can still fail during international transit.
Ask for an assembled packaging sample and final packed-carton measurements for how to avoid hidden charges in fcl shipping from china so freight and landed cost can be updated before shipment.
